I have the following array, which was retrieved from JSON results:

<NSCFArray 0x196e3e0>(  
{  
NameID = 3;  
Name = test1;  
},  
{  
NameID = 6;  
Name = test2;  
}  
)

I’d like to go through each object via a tableview and assign its values to labels in a custom tableview cell. How do I access NameID and Name on each iteration? Do I need to create a class with those two properties and assign to it from the array?

    Assuming the array is something like:

    NSArray * array = [NSArray arrayWithObjects:
        [NSDictionary dictionaryWithObjectsAndKeys:
            [NSNumber numberWithInt:3], @"NameID", @"test1", @"Name", nil],
        [NSDictionary dictionaryWithObjectsAndKeys:
            [NSNumber numberWithInt:6], @"NameID", @"test2", @"Name", nil],
        nil];
    

    You can iterate it like this:

    NSEnumerator *enumerator = [array objectEnumerator];
    id obj;
    while ((obj = [enumerator nextObject]))
    {
        NSLog(@"NameID:[%@]; Name:[%@]",
            [obj objectForKey:@"NameID"],
            [obj objectForKey:@"Name"]);
    }
    

    Output:

    2010-02-04 11:41:53.266 x[8739] NameID:[3]; Name:[test1]
    2010-02-04 11:41:53.267 x[8739] NameID:[6]; Name:[test2]
